About the event

We all have textiles that are no longer useful, but hate the idea of throwing them away. Learn how to upcycle the ubiquitous fabric of denim at our Upcycled Denim Workshop! You will turn denim into beautiful flowers using both the raw edge wabi-sabi and beeswax coated methods. You will have the opportunity to make and take home several flowers which can be bundled into a bouquet, or worn as a decorative pin.

Denim will be provided, but if you want to bring your own, please do! Take your flowers and the skills you learned home and give that pile of old clothes a new life by turning it into something beautiful and neat.

About the instructor:

The daughter of a Mexican mother and American father, Robin Schweitzer grew up in the Bronx. After a successful 38-year career in the fashion industry, Robin founded the HOOP in New York City. Born out of her childhood summers in Mexico City stitching alongside her grandmother, mother, aunts and cousins, the HOOP serves as an untethered hangout of curious creatives to fastidiously learn stitching, fiber craft, and life lessons, too.
